Use of Technology in Art Card Creation
Technology plays a pivotal role in shaping art card designs this 2026. Augmented reality and interactive elements are becoming commonplace, allowing creators to engage audiences in innovative ways. For instance, a card may feature a QR code that, when scanned, brings the artwork to life through animation or storytelling. This blending of physical and digital art opens new avenues for creativity and interaction.
- Augmented reality features in cards
- Interactive elements that engage users
- Digital printing techniques for precision
Eco-Friendly Materials and Sustainable Practices
As sustainability continues to be a priority in 2026, many artists are turning to eco-friendly materials for their art cards. Recycled paper, plant-based inks, and biodegradable materials are gaining popularity among designers who wish to reduce their environmental impact. This shift not only reflects a growing awareness of ecological issues but also appeals to consumers who prioritize sustainability in their purchasing decisions.

Designing for Special Occasions
Designing art cards for special occasions remains a staple in the industry, but in 2026, the approach is evolving. Personalized and custom designs are becoming increasingly popular, allowing recipients to feel a unique connection to the card. This trend is particularly evident in wedding invitations, holiday cards, and birthday greetings, where personal touches can transform a simple card into a cherished keepsake.
Consider the example of a wedding invitation designed in 2026. Instead of standard templates, couples are seeking bespoke designs that reflect their love story. Artists are collaborating with clients to create invitations that incorporate meaningful symbols, colors, and even photographs, making each card a unique representation of the couple's journey.
